The purpose – to improve and develop new methods of developing an original initial breeding material and using it to develope sunflower hybrids, including ones with changed fatty acid composition. Methods – hybridological analysis, laboratory, field, statistical. Results: a new integrated index is suggested for female lines and hybrids selection - specific combining ability for oil yield from a hectare which is characterised by closer correlation with specific combining ability for other traits, and provides much higher potential of adaptability and stability, the highest seed and oil productivity of simple and three-way hybrids. It was found that female simple hybrids possessed higher adaptive potential, than self-pollinated female lines. Introduction: the hybrids Suchsnyk, Tembr, Uragan, Chygyryn, Vyvat have been transferred to the State Variety Trial.
